Identity -not titles -will determine relevance 2026+
By 2026, the most dangerous career risk will not be automation.
It will be identity lag.
Across BFSI, corporates, education, creative fields, and startups, people are still describing themselves using job titles designed for a pre-AI world.
Analyst. Manager. Teacher. Designer. Consultant. These labels once explained responsibility. Today, they hide it.
AI has not replaced work. It has unbundled it.
Tasks are faster. Outputs are cheaper. Execution is abundant.
What has become scarce is judgment, context, accountability, and trust.
This creates a psychological fracture. People feel busy but unsure. Skilled but anxious. Employed yet insecure.
The problem is not competence. It is that most professionals are optimizing inside roles that no longer anchor value.

Beyond Exams: From Knowledge Holders to Decision Owners
For decades, BFSI careers in Bharat have been structured around certifications, roles, and seniority ladders. Exams proved diligence. Titles implied authority.
Post-2026, this structure is under visible stress. AI now handles calculations, reconciliations, document checks, and even first-level compliance reviews. What remains valuable is no longer knowing rules - but interpreting impact.
Example:
Two professionals pass the same regulatory exam. One can recite circulars.
The other can explain how a circular changes onboarding risk, customer friction,
and operational flow. In meetings, the second person is consulted -
even without a higher designation.
Action Steps:
- Reframe every regulation as a decision tree, not a memory unit
- Practice answering: “What changes if this rule is misunderstood?”
- Build professional identity around risk judgment, not rule recall
HCAM™ Mental Model:
📊 Rule → Interpretation → Decision → Accountability
Your identity survives when you own the middle two layers.
HCAM™ Signal:
In BFSI, the future belongs to those who explain consequences - not clauses.

֎ AI Literacy for Bharat
From Tool Confidence to Judgment Authority
AI literacy is exploding - but most learners stop at tool fluency: prompts, apps, workflows. This creates short-term confidence but long-term anxiety.
Why? Because tools change faster than identities.
Example:
A professional who knows five AI tools panics when one shuts down.
Another who understands where AI helps - and where it must not decide -
remains calm even when platforms shift.
Action Steps:
- Explicitly list decisions you will never delegate to AI
- Use AI to explore options, not to make final calls
- Practice explaining why you accepted or rejected an AI output
HCAM™ Mental Model:
🧠 Human Judgment (Core) → 🤖 AI Assistance (Layer)
Invert this, and dependency replaces confidence.
HCAM™ Signal:
AI fluency without judgment is speed without direction.

🧩 HCAM™ Special Corner 🧠 HCAM™ Anchoring Identity, Expanding Context
The HCAM™ Work Identity Lens:
Most conversations about the future of work focus on skills, tools, or roles.
HCAM™ takes a different stance: clarity precedes capability.
HCAM™ Work Identity Design is a psychological framework - not a career hack.
🔍 The HCAM™ Diagnosis:
When professionals feel anxious about AI, the root cause is rarely technical. It is almost always identity diffusion:
- Too many tools
- Too many expectations
- Too little clarity about what they uniquely own
HCAM™ reframes work identity using four anchors:
- Cognitive Anchor (What I Understand): Your mental models, pattern recognition, and contextual awareness
- Decision Anchor (What I Decide): The calls that cannot be outsourced without risk or ethical loss
- Accountability Anchor (What I Own): Outcomes that carry your name - success or failure
- Delegation Anchor (What Machines Do): Speed, scale, repetition, and optimization
🧠 Why This Matters
AI accelerates execution - but only humans stabilize meaning.
Without HCAM™ clarity, professionals:
- Overwork without leverage
- Learn endlessly without confidence
- Feel replaceable despite competence
With HCAM™ clarity, AI becomes assistive infrastructure, not an identity threat.

Why are job titles becoming obsolete after 2026?
Job titles were designed for stable, slow-changing systems. AI has broken that assumption. Today, tasks change faster than titles can adapt. Two people with the same designation often deliver radically different value depending on judgment, accountability, and clarity. AI automates execution layers, exposing whether a role actually owns decisions or merely processes information. This is why titles increasingly fail to explain relevance. Edition #09 argues that identity must shift from static labels to dynamic capability ownership. Those who redesign their identity around what they decide, explain, and take responsibility for remain relevant - even as titles change.

How does Work Identity Reset apply to BFSI professionals?
In BFSI, exams and regulations remain essential - but insufficient. AI can parse rules faster than humans. What it cannot do reliably is interpret consequences across risk, compliance, and customer impact. Professionals who shift identity from rule recall to decision interpretation become indispensable. This edition helps BFSI readers move from certification-driven confidence to judgment-based authority.
